2024 Publishing Award Recipient Examines Impact of PA Practice Environment on Wages

Ryan D. White, PhD, PA-C , is the recipient of the 2024 Publishing Award as the author of “Examining the Influence of PA Scope of Practice Reforms and Individual Characteristics on Wages,” which investigated how the PA practice environment impacts PA compensation and was published in Medical Care Research and Review.

CO Outreach and Advocacy Award Recipient Strives to Empower PAs

The recipient of the 2023 CO Outreach and Advocacy Award is the Minnesota Academy of PAs (MAPA). MAPA utilized its 12 committees to provide PAs with CME opportunities, further diversity, equity and inclusion, advance advocacy initiatives, and more.

Annual PA Compensation Continues Rising, Increases 5.8%

Physician associate/physician assistant (PA) base compensation, without bonuses, continued to rise in 2023, increasing 5.8% from $120,000 in 2022 to $127,000 in 2023. The findings were released in the 2024 American Academy of Physician Associates (AAPA) Digital Salary Report.
